When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Mandalay?
The hottest months are usually April and March, with an average temperature of 31°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of 23°C. The rainiest months in Mandalay are August, October, September and July, with each month seeing an average of 204 mm of rainfall.

What's the best way for us to get around Mandalay?
If you want to explore the larger area, hop on a train at Mandalay Central Railway Station. Mandalay may not have many public transport options, so consider renting a car to explore more.
